Who We Are

DMV Ambassadors serve as a crucial link between Donate Life North Carolina and individual North Carolina Department of Motor Vehicle (NC DMV) offices. It would be difficult for one staff member to visit all 100+ offices each quarter. Therefore, Donate Life NC relies on its DMV Ambassadors to act as the liaison between the offices and the nonprofit organization, connecting our 700+ examiners responsible for registering 99% of the state's organ, eye and tissue donors to our mission. 

What We Do

 Essential Duties and Responsibilities:

 

  • Visit “adopted” DMV office(s) once three times each year
  • Bring and share materials (i.e. newsletters, Thank You cards) provided by Donate Life NC at each quarterly visit
  • Ensure Donate Life NC materials are visible and in good condition within DMV office (i.e. countertop stand, floor display)
  • Complete DMV Visit Report after each DMV office visit per quarter
  • Answer questions of DMV Examiners and customers related to donation, registering to be a donor, etc.
  • Attend training sessions, meetings, and other annual events sponsored by Donate Life NC
  • Maintain open communication with Donate Life NC staff
  • Other duties as assigned
